For me: Octavarium - Dream Theater. DT's my favorite band and they have number of albums that are in my top 10 but this one's at the top. I can listen to it over and over. The title track "Octavarium" is one of their epic 20+ min songs, taking you all over the map. The Odyssey - Symphony X. Symp X follows in the mold of DT, but more straight forward progressive metal. I find it rather interesting that a band could take something like Greek Mythology and turn it into an album. Deadwing - Porcupine Tree. PT has a number of other really good albums (In Absentia, Signify, Fear of a Blank Planet), but for me this is their go to album. They've been described as a modern day Pink Floyd. I can't say for sure myself as I haven't listened to a lot of Floyd. Liquid Tension Experiment - Liquid Tension Experiment. A side project of some of the Dream Theater guys, this is a completely instrumental album with loads of jazz fusion influences. There's a song called "3 Minute Warning" that's over 20+ minutes and was recorded in one take. It's a complete improv jam.
